Jessie Kaufman (Edmonton, AB) won 5-3 over Eve Muirhead (Stirling, SCO) in the Final of the Meyers Norris Penny Charity Classic, held October 15 - 18, 2010 at the Medicine Hat Curling Club in Medicine Hat, Canada. To advance to the championship game, Kaufman won 7-5 over Lindsay Makichuk (Lloydminster, AB) in the semifinals of the 2010 Meyers Norris Penny Charity Classic in Medicine Hat, Alberta, Canada; and won 6-4 over Casey Scheidegger (Calgary, AB) in the quarterfinals. of the 2010 Meyers Norris Penny Charity Classic in Medicine Hat, Alberta, Canada;
 
Kaufman finished 5-1 in the 32-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Kaufman lost 7-6 to British Columbia's Jerri Pat Armstrong-Smith, then responded with a 9-0 win over Michelle Corbeil (Lloydminster, AB). Kaufman won 8-5 against Alberta's Arlene Keck, then won 7-5 against Crystal Webster (Calgary, AB) and 6-4 against Lisa Johnson (Edmonton, AB). Kaufman won 7-4 against Makichuk in their final qualifying round match.
 
For winning the Meyers Norris Penny Charity Classic Championship title, Kaufman earned 19.840 world rankings points along with the $8,000CDN first prize cheque, moving up 14 spots the World Ranking Standings into 29th place overall with 47.353 total points. Kaufman ranks 4th over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 41.650 points earned so far this season.
